Ordinals
beta
Address bc1qmlksxprwvcstmp6nuz2yf7yxun530zrh8x5qvl
sat balance
24942290
outputs
ab7f6ccfffc7d6c9ff45e7e1fa5c086064324a7a3a5c09ebe836c2057ed070eb:1